The Meat Processing Industry A Vital Sector


The meat processing industry plays a crucial role in the global food supply chain, transforming raw livestock into a wide variety of meat products consumed by billions every day. This industry includes a range of activities such as slaughtering, cutting, packaging, and distributing meat products, which are essential for meeting the growing demand for protein-rich foods.

In addition to efficiency, sustainability has become a key focus for many meat processing companies. The industry faces increasing pressure to adopt environmentally friendly practices, from sourcing livestock to waste management. Many factories are implementing measures to reduce their carbon footprint, such as utilizing renewable energy sources, optimizing water usage, and recycling by-products. Some companies have even started exploring plant-based alternatives and lab-grown meat products to address consumer preferences for sustainable and ethical food options.

The workforce in the meat processing industry is diverse, comprising skilled laborers, technicians, and management professionals. Workers are often trained in safety protocols and animal welfare standards, ensuring that the processing of meat is not only efficient but also humane. However, the industry also faces challenges, such as labor shortages and the need for continuous training to keep up with technological advancements.


Another critical dimension of the meat processing industry is its economic impact. It provides thousands of jobs worldwide and contributes significantly to local and national economies. The industry also supports agricultural sectors by creating a market for livestock, which in turn stimulates rural economies. However, fluctuations in meat prices due to market demand, feed costs, and trade policies can pose challenges to stability within the industry.


Consumer preferences are continually evolving, with an increasing focus on transparency, health, and sustainability. This shift is prompting meat processing companies to adapt their products to meet these new demands. Innovations such as cleaner label products with fewer additives, organic options, and ethically sourced meats are becoming more prevalent as companies strive to align with consumer values.


In conclusion, the meat processing industry is a complex and vital sector that not only plays a significant role in food production but also impacts economic and environmental spheres. As it continues to evolve, embracing innovation and sustainability will be crucial for meeting future demands while ensuring safety and quality in the products delivered to consumers.
